While train travel in Europe offers many benefits, it's not without its challenges. Delays, language barriers, and navigating unfamiliar train stations can be frustrating for travelers. However, with a little bit of preparation and research, these pain points can be minimized. By familiarizing yourself with the train schedule, purchasing tickets in advance, and downloading language translation apps, you can make your train travel experience in Europe much smoother. One of the best things about train travel in Europe is the abundance of tourist attractions you can visit. From the historic landmarks of Paris to the stunning beaches of the Amalfi Coast, there's something for everyone. For history buffs, a trip to Berlin to witness the remnants of the Berlin Wall is a must-see. For foodies, a journey through Italy's culinary capital of Bologna will tantalize your taste buds. And for nature lovers, a scenic train ride through Switzerland's Alps offers stunning views of the mountains and valleys. Question and Answer
Q: How far in advance should I purchase train tickets in Europe? A: It's recommended to purchase train tickets at least 2-3 months in advance to ensure availability and lower prices. Q: Are there any discounts for train travel in Europe? A: Yes, there are various discounts available for train travel in Europe, including youth discounts, senior discounts, and group discounts. Q: Can I bring my luggage on the train? A: Yes, you can bring luggage on the train. However, there are size and weight restrictions, so be sure to check with the train company beforehand. Q: Are there sleeper trains available for overnight travel? A: Yes, there are sleeper trains available for overnight travel. These trains offer private cabins with beds and are a great way to save time and money on travel.
